Hillwood Seeks Buyer for 148-Acre Austin Site Entitled for 1.4MM SQFT Logistics Park

Dallas-based Hillwood has put roughly 148 acres in Northeast Austin up for sale, including 118 acres entitled for Premier Logistics Park, a planned six-building distribution campus of about 1.4 million square feet, as the region's industrial market wrestles with elevated vacancy.
